Transaction e85671a8366108cda77f592a4651ec1865919e9dde5fa86da17a627c08ed3d71

1 Input
2 Outputs
  • e85671a8366108cda77f592a4651ec1865919e9dde5fa86da17a627c08ed3d71:0
  • value  704925828
    address  bc1qnryjcw37ugdna6njrjxdr4zqsspthygjyx7ev5
  • e85671a8366108cda77f592a4651ec1865919e9dde5fa86da17a627c08ed3d71:1
  • value  2416100
    address  3FMqfwUDkkAoS3q35YQmjTHXkwXqha3hR6